§ 20-13-15. Failure to render assistance to injured person.

Any person causing an injury to another person by firearm or arrow while hunting failing to render assistance to the injured person shall, in addition to any other penalties provided by law, be subject to a fine of up to one thousand dollars ($1,000) or imprisonment for up to one year, or both.
